4 Ways You Can Improve Energy Savings This Year

Energy bills. You know they’re coming, but somehow they always catch you off-guard. The worst part is looking at the numbers and thinking “That can’t be right”. Even though it feels like you’re not using that much energy, the bills go up, adding up to your monthly expenses. It’s not an uncommon situation.

Fortunately, there are ways you can improve energy savings. Here are 4 of them:

1. Find and seal leaks in your home

This might seem like a no-brainer, but you’ll be surprised by how many people are actually unaware this is a problem that contributes to their energy expenses going up, especially during the cold winter months.

It’s important to mention that air leaks can occur all over your home. Some are pretty obvious, such as under-the-door drafts or air leaks around your windows for instance. To improve energy savings, you also need to find the less obvious gaps. For that, you should inspect:

  • The area where siding and chimneys meet.
  • Plumbing lines.
  • Power outlets.
  • Attic hatches.
  • Exterior corners.

That’s just to name a few, but we’re sure you get the idea. If you want to be completely sure you didn’t miss any leaks and you have some money you want to invest, you can always just hire a qualified technician to conduct a home energy assessment.

2. Adjust your thermostat to improve energy savings

Many people forget to adjust the temperature in their homes according to their day-to-day activities. The best thing you can do is program your thermostat so that it’s synced with the life you and your family lead. Small tweaks such as setting a lower temperature when you are asleep or out of the house can really make a big difference.

Programming your thermostat to energy-saving settings will cost you nothing, but it could end up saving you a lot of money in the long run.

3. Use energy-efficient light bulbs

This is a great tip you can use all year long to help you improve your energy savings. All you have to do is replace old light bulbs with LEDs or CFLs. The best choice would be LEDs even though they are pricier.

Why? Because quality LED light bulbs not only last longer, but also offer comparable or better light quality than other types of lighting. This way, you will be able to improve energy savings without having to make a compromise when it comes to your comfort.

4. Insulate your home

Proper insulation minimizes the exchange of heat through a surface such as a wall, roof or attic. During the winter, insulation prevents the warm air from escaping your home, while keeping the cool air in during the summer months.improve energy savings

This means the heating and cooling systems will have to use less energy to warm or cool the air in your home. The better insulated the walls, floors and roof are, the more money you will be able to save on your monthly energy bills. Makes sense, right?
